@ -1043,6 +1043,93 @@ const (
DNSDefault DNSPolicy = "Default"
)
// A node selector represents the union of the results of one or more label queries
// over a set of nodes; that is, it represents the OR of the selectors represented
// by the node selector terms.
type NodeSelector struct {
//Required. A list of node selector terms. The terms are ORed.
NodeSelectorTerms []NodeSelectorTerm `json:"nodeSelectorTerms"`
}
// A null or empty node selector term matches no objects.
type NodeSelectorTerm struct {
//Required. A list of node selector requirements. The requirements are ANDed.
MatchExpressions []NodeSelectorRequirement `json:"matchExpressions"`
}
// A node selector requirement is a selector that contains values, a key, and an operator
// that relates the key and values.
type NodeSelectorRequirement struct {
// The label key that the selector applies to.
Key string `json:"key" patchStrategy:"merge" patchMergeKey:"key"`
// Represents a key's relationship to a set of values.
// Valid operators are In, NotIn, Exists, DoesNotExist. Gt, and Lt.
Operator NodeSelectorOperator `json:"operator"`
// An array of string values. If the operator is In or NotIn,
// the values array must be non-empty. If the operator is Exists or DoesNotExist,
// the values array must be empty. If the operator is Gt or Lt, the values
// array must have a single element, which will be interpreted as an integer.
// This array is replaced during a strategic merge patch.
Values []string `json:"values,omitempty"`
}
// A node selector operator is the set of operators that can be used in
// a node selector requirement.
type NodeSelectorOperator string
const (
NodeSelectorOpIn NodeSelectorOperator = "In"
NodeSelectorOpNotIn NodeSelectorOperator = "NotIn"
NodeSelectorOpExists NodeSelectorOperator = "Exists"
NodeSelectorOpDoesNotExist NodeSelectorOperator = "DoesNotExist"
NodeSelectorOpGt NodeSelectorOperator = "Gt"
NodeSelectorOpLt NodeSelectorOperator = "Lt"
)
// Affinity is a group of affinity scheduling requirements.
type Affinity struct {
// Describes node affinity scheduling requirements for the pod.
NodeAffinity *NodeAffinity `json:"nodeAffinity,omitempty"`
}
// Node affinity is a group of node affinity scheduling requirements.
// If RequiredDuringSchedulingRequiredDuringExecution and
// RequiredDuringSchedulingIgnoredDuringExecution are both set,
// then both node selectors must be satisfied.
type NodeAffinity struct {
// If the affinity requirements specified by this field are not met at
// scheduling time, the pod will not be scheduled onto the node.
// If the affinity requirements specified by this field cease to be met
// at some point during pod execution (e.g. due to an update), the system
// will try to eventually evict the pod from its node.
RequiredDuringSchedulingRequiredDuringExecution *NodeSelector `json:"requiredDuringSchedulingRequiredDuringExecution,omitempty"`
// If the affinity requirements specified by this field are not met at
// scheduling time, the pod will not be scheduled onto the node.
// If the affinity requirements specified by this field cease to be met
// at some point during pod execution (e.g. due to an update), the system
// may or may not try to eventually evict the pod from its node.
RequiredDuringSchedulingIgnoredDuringExecution *NodeSelector `json:"requiredDuringSchedulingIgnoredDuringExecution,omitempty"`
// The scheduler will prefer to schedule pods to nodes that satisfy
// the affinity expressions specified by this field, but it may choose
// a node that violates one or more of the expressions. The node that is
// most preferred is the one with the greatest sum of weights, i.e.
// for each node that meets all of the scheduling requirements (resource
// request, requiredDuringScheduling affinity expressions, etc.),
// compute a sum by iterating through the elements of this field and adding
// "weight" to the sum if the node matches the corresponding matchExpressions; the
// node(s) with the highest sum are the most preferred.
PreferredDuringSchedulingIgnoredDuringExecution []PreferredSchedulingTerm `json:"preferredDuringSchedulingIgnoredDuringExecution,omitempty"`
}
// An empty preferred scheduling term matches all objects with implicit weight 0
// (i.e. it's a no-op). A null preferred scheduling term matches no objects (i.e. is also a no-op).
type PreferredSchedulingTerm struct {
// Weight associated with matching the corresponding nodeSelectorTerm, in the range 1-100.
Weight int `json:"weight"`
// A node selector term, associated with the corresponding weight.
Preference NodeSelectorTerm `json:"preference"`
}

// CalculateNodeAffinityPriority prioritizes nodes according to node affinity scheduling preferences
// indicated in PreferredDuringSchedulingIgnoredDuringExecution. Each time a node match a preferredSchedulingTerm,
// it will a get an add of preferredSchedulingTerm.Weight. Thus, the more preferredSchedulingTerms
// the node satisfies and the more the preferredSchedulingTerm that is satisfied weights, the higher
// score the node gets.
func (s *NodeAffinity) CalculateNodeAffinityPriority(pod *api.Pod, machinesToPods map[string][]*api.Pod, podLister algorithm.PodLister, nodeLister algorithm.NodeLister) (schedulerapi.HostPriorityList, error) {
var maxCount int
counts := map[string]int{}
nodes, err := nodeLister.List()
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
affinity, err := api.GetAffinityFromPodAnnotations(pod.Annotations)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
// A nil element of PreferredDuringSchedulingIgnoredDuringExecution matches no objects.
// An element of PreferredDuringSchedulingIgnoredDuringExecution that refers to an
// empty PreferredSchedulingTerm matches all objects.
if affinity.NodeAffinity != nil && affinity.NodeAffinity.PreferredDuringSchedulingIgnoredDuringExecution != nil {
// Match PreferredDuringSchedulingIgnoredDuringExecution term by term.
for _, preferredSchedulingTerm := range affinity.NodeAffinity.PreferredDuringSchedulingIgnoredDuringExecution {
if preferredSchedulingTerm.Weight == 0 {
continue
}
nodeSelector, err := api.NodeSelectorRequirementsAsSelector(preferredSchedulingTerm.Preference.MatchExpressions)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
for _, node := range nodes.Items {
if nodeSelector.Matches(labels.Set(node.Labels)) {
counts[node.Name] += preferredSchedulingTerm.Weight
}
if counts[node.Name] > maxCount {
maxCount = counts[node.Name]
}
}
}
}
result := []schedulerapi.HostPriority{}
for _, node := range nodes.Items {
fScore := float64(0)
if maxCount > 0 {
fScore = 10 * (float64(counts[node.Name]) / float64(maxCount))
}
result = append(result, schedulerapi.HostPriority{Host: node.Name, Score: int(fScore)})
glog.V(10).Infof("%v -> %v: NodeAffinityPriority, Score: (%d)", pod.Name, node.Name, int(fScore))
}
return result, nil
}
